The sleepy marsupial

Koalas are tree‑dwelling marsupials native to Australia and found almost exclusively in the eucalyptus forests in eastern and southeastern regions of the country. Their extremely specific and low energy diet of eucalyptus leaves means they sleep for between 18 to 22 hours a day, often curled into the forks of their tree.

Liberty Bell privy mark

The coin’s reverse portrays a coloured representation of a koala perched in a eucalyptus tree, holding a leafy branch in its mouth surrounded by native foliage. The design features a privy mark of the Liberty Bell, a powerful symbol of freedom and independence. The design includes the inscriptions ‘KOALA’ and The Perth Mint’s ‘P’ mintmark, as well as the coin’s weight, purity and 2026 year-date.
